Today’s Difficulty

The difficulty of each puzzle is determined by averaging the number of guesses provided by a panel of testers who are paid to solve each puzzle in advance to help us catch any issues and inconsistencies.

Today’s average difficulty is 5.7 guesses out of six, or very challenging. The word’s unique letter pattern makes it so.

For more in-depth analysis, visit our friend, WordleBot.

Today’s word is QUEUE, a noun and verb. According to Webster’s New World College Dictionary, it can refer to a line of people or vehicles waiting as to be served.

Our Featured Artist

Julia Dufossé, of Austin, Texas, is an illustrator specializing in surreal and atmospheric illustrations. Originally trained as an academic historian, Ms. Dufossé left her doctorate program at the University of Chicago in 2019 to pursue art full time. Her work is inspired by the beauty of the textures in airbrush art of the 1970s and 1980s. Ms. Dufossé has worked with companies including Apple, Moncler and National Geographic.
